Harnessing the Power of Infrared: A Look at FLIR Thermal Imaging

The world we perceive is limited by our eyes, which can only detect a narrow band of electromagnetic radiation known as visible light. However, beyond this visible spectrum lies a wealth of information hidden in infrared (IR) radiation, which emits heat energy. Infrared cameras leverage this power, revealing temperature variations invisible to the human eye. This exceptional technology has revolutionized numerous fields, from search and rescue operations to astronomy. By detecting these minute heat differences, FLIR cameras offer a unique perspective on our surroundings, enabling users to identify problems, monitor performance, and enhance safety in ways never before possible.
